Comprehending the Ignition System
Before diving into expenses, it's necessary to comprehend what an ignition system requires. A typical ignition system comprises numerous parts, including:
Ignition Coil: Converts low battery voltage into the high voltage required to create a spark.Ignition Module: Controls the timing of the trigger.Stimulate Plugs: Deliver the spark to spark the air-fuel mix in the engine's cylinders.Distributor: Routes the high-voltage existing from the ignition coil to the suitable stimulate plug.
When any of these parts malfunction, it can lead to tough starting, sputtering, or the engine stopping working to start altogether.
Typical Costs of Ignition Repairs
The cost of ignition repairs can differ significantly based on the make and design of the car, the particular concern pestering the ignition system, and where the repairs are carried out (dealer vs. independent mechanic). Below is a breakdown of possible costs connected with typical ignition repairs:
Type of RepairTypical CostIgnition Coil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300Stimulate Plug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300 (for a set)Ignition Module Replacement₤ 150 - ₤ 400Supplier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 600Key Fob Programming₤ 50 - ₤ 1001. Ignition Coil Replacement
The ignition coil is one of the most common components to stop working. Diagnostic codes can easily determine ignition coil failures, making replacement reasonably straightforward. The average cost typically ranges from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300, depending upon labor charges and parts rates.
2. Trigger Plug Replacement
Routine maintenance of stimulate plugs is critical, as they can break down in time, leading to poor engine performance. Changing spark plugs generally costs in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300, depending upon the car's engine style and labor rates.
3. Ignition Module Replacement
If the ignition module stops working, it can trigger beginning concerns and poor engine efficiency. Replacing this part usually costs in between ₤ 150 and ₤ 400.
4. Supplier Replacement
In older lorries that count on distributors, changing one can be rather pricey, balancing in between ₤ 200 and ₤ 600.
5. Key Fob Programming
Modern vehicles frequently come equipped with key fobs that can stop working or require reprogramming. This service typically costs between ₤ 50 and ₤ 100.
Elements Influencing Repair Costs
Numerous variables can affect the total cost of ignition repairs:
Make and Model of the Vehicle: Luxury or imported lorries often have greater repair costs due to specialized parts and labor.Place: Labor rates can differ substantially by region, with metropolitan areas normally charging more than rural regions.Kind Of Repair Shop: Dealerships usually charge greater prices compared to independent mechanics, however they might provide specialized competence.Part Quality: O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ts tend to be more expensive but are typically recommended for reliability.Indications Your Ignition System Needs Attention
It's vital for vehicle owners to be watchful about any signs of ignition failure. Typical signs consist of:
The engine turns over however stops working to begin.The car stalls unexpectedly.Difficulty starting the car, particularly in winter.Reduced engine efficiency, consisting of misfiring or rough idling.
Prompt attention to these symptoms can save lorry owners substantial money and time.

What triggers ignition system failures?
Ignition system failures can result from several issues, consisting of worn-out stimulate plugs, a defective ignition coil, or a malfunctioning ignition module.
2. How can I inform if my ignition coil is bad?
Common signs of a failing ignition coil consist of engine misfires, bad fuel economy, and difficulty beginning the car.
3. Can I drive my car with a bad ignition system?
It is not recommended to drive with a stopping working ignition system, as it can cause additional damage or total engine failure.
4. How typically should I replace my trigger plugs?
The majority of makers suggest changing stimulate plugs every 30,000 to 100,000 miles, depending on the kind of plugs utilized.
5. What are the advantages of regular ignition system maintenance?
Regular maintenance can assist avoid expensive breakdowns, enhance fuel efficiency, and make sure trustworthy engine efficiency.
